When making retro-style games (like Daggerfall or classic Doom-era titles),
3D characters are often represented as pre-rendered 2D sprites from multiple angles.
Creating these by hand is tedious and inconsistent.
SpriteForge automates the process: given a .obj model and a texture,
it renders 8 directional views (BACK_LEFT, BACK, BACK_RIGHT, RIGHT, FRONT_RIGHT, FRONT, FRONT_LEFT, LEFT) using OpenGL
and saves each frame as a PNG sprite, ready to use in your game engine.
Two modes are supported:
- Static mode — render a single model from all 8 directions.
- Animation mode — render a sequence of OBJ frames (e.g. a walking cycle) from all 8 directions, producing a full directional animation set.
Each direction is saved into its own subfolder. Optionally, it can also produce a single sprite sheet with all 8 directions combined.
The camera elevation, sprite size, and background color are all configurable.
Transparent backgrounds are supported for direct use in engines without chroma keying.

pip3 install PyOpenGL PyOpenGL_accelerate pygame Pillow numpyRender a single model from 8 directions:
python render_sprites.py --model model.obj --texture texture.pngRender a sequence of OBJ frames from 8 directions.
Frames can be specified as a printf-style pattern, an explicit list, or a pattern with a known frame count:
# Auto-discover frames matching a pattern
python render_sprites.py --texture texture.png --animation walking_%06d.obj
# Specify exact frame count
python render_sprites.py --texture texture.png --animation 12 walking_%06d.obj
# Explicit list of files
